With a few clever “Bouquets of Flowers Hacks Inside!”, anyone can craft picture-perfect arrangements that look straight out of a designer shop.🌼 H2: Essential Tools & MaterialsBefore we get to the fun part, here’s what you’ll need to get started:🌿 Basic SuppliesFresh flowers (a mix of focal, filler, and greenery)Floral scissors or sharp shearsFloral tape or twineVase, jar, or floral foam (for stability)Clean water and flower food💡 Pro Tip: Always use clean tools and fresh water to keep your flowers vibrant longer!🌸 H2: Bouquets of Flowers Hacks Inside!Here come the clever tricks and insider secrets that make your arrangements pop with life and beauty.🌷 H3: Hack #1 – Choose a Color PaletteA harmonious color scheme is key to a visually stunning bouquet.Romantic look: Soft pinks, whites, and blush tones.Vibrant feel: Reds, oranges, and yellows.Modern minimalism: Whites and greens.💐 Pro Tip: Stick to 3 main colors for a balanced and elegant composition.🌺 H3: Hack #2 – Mix Flower Types for TextureA bouquet becomes visually dynamic when you mix textures and shapes.Include these three flower types in every bouquet:Focal flowers – large blooms like roses, lilies, or peonies.Secondary flowers – mid-sized fillers like carnations or tulips.Greenery/fillers – eucalyptus, ferns, or baby’s breath.This layering trick gives your arrangement depth and dimension.🌻 H3: Hack #3 – Spiral Stemming TechniqueThe “spiral technique” is a florist’s best-kept secret for balanced, professional-looking bouquets.Here’s how to do it:Hold one main flower in your hand.Add each new stem at a slight angle, rotating the bouquet as you go.Once done, tie the stems tightly with floral tape or ribbon.The spiral formation ensures the bouquet stands beautifully and fans out evenly. 🌸🌷 H3: Hack #4 – Trim Stems the Smart WayAlways cut stems diagonally (at a 45° angle). This increases water absorption and keeps flowers hydrated longer.💧 Refresh the water and recut stems every 2–3 days for longevity.🌺 H3: Hack #5 – Use Unexpected GreeneryWant your bouquet to stand out? Mix in unique foliage like:Olive branchesSilver dollar eucalyptusRosemary or mint (for scent!)Dusty miller leavesGreenery adds contrast and fragrance while filling empty spaces beautifully.🌸 H3: Hack #6 – Play with Height and ShapeDon’t make your bouquet too uniform — variation is key!Place larger blooms in the center.Use shorter flowers or greenery around the edges.Let a few stems “dance” above the rest for a natural, garden-fresh feel.💐 Pro Tip: Odd numbers of flowers (like 3, 5, or 7) look more balanced and appealing than even numbers.🌼 H3: Hack #7 – Wrap Like a ProIf you’re gifting your bouquet, presentation matters!Use kraft paper, tissue, or linen fabric for a chic look. Wrap it loosely, tie with a twine bow, and finish with a sprig of greenery tucked in the ribbon.✨ Eco-friendly tip: Use biodegradable paper or reusable cloth wraps.🌸 H2: Creative Bouquets of Flowers IdeasNow that you’ve mastered the Bouquets of Flowers Hacks Inside!, here are some fun and stylish ideas for your next arrangement:🌷 1. The Rustic Garden BouquetCombine lavender, daisies, and wildflowers for a natural country charm. Perfect for picnics or casual home decor.🌺 2. The Romantic Rose MixPair red roses with pink carnations, baby’s breath, and eucalyptus — a timeless favorite for anniversaries and Valentine’s Day.🌻 3. The Modern MinimalistWhite lilies, greenery, and simple textures. Sleek, elegant, and perfect for contemporary spaces.🌸 4. The Seasonal SurpriseUse seasonal blooms for freshness and affordability — sunflowers in summer, tulips in spring, or chrysanthemums in autumn.🌼 5. The DIY Dried Flower BouquetDry your favorite flowers upside-down and spray lightly with hairspray to preserve them. These last months and add a vintage touch to your space.💐 H2: Bonus Hacks for Longer-Lasting Bouquets✅ Remove lower leaves so they don’t sit in water and rot.✅ Use flower food or a homemade mix (1 tsp sugar + 1 tsp vinegar per quart of water).✅ Avoid direct sunlight and keep bouquets in cool areas.✅ Mist with water daily to maintain freshness.✅ Add a penny to the vase — copper helps prevent bacterial growth!🌹 H2: Why Everyone Loves Bouquets of FlowersBouquets have been a universal symbol of beauty and affection for centuries.
